The Challenge of Maintaining Health in Refugee Camps
Maintaining health in refugee camps presents a complex challenge due to numerous interconnected factors. Overcrowding significantly increases the risk of disease transmission, making infection control difficult in densely populated settings. Limited access to clean water and sanitation facilities further exacerbates health vulnerabilities among refugees.
The infrastructure constraints often hinder effective healthcare delivery, resulting in delayed diagnosis and treatment of preventable illnesses. Additionally, shortages of medical supplies and trained personnel hamper ongoing health interventions and disease surveillance efforts. Displacement due to conflict or war complicates efforts to establish consistent health services, as camps are frequently temporary and poorly equipped.
War refugees face the additional burden of trauma and stress, which can weaken immune systems and increase susceptibility to disease. Addressing these challenges requires coordinated efforts from international agencies and NGOs, focusing on improving infrastructure, resource allocation, and community engagement. Ensuring health in refugee camps remains a persistent challenge amidst ongoing displacement and resource limitations.
Common Disease Outbreaks in Refugee Camps
Refugee camps are often susceptible to outbreaks of communicable diseases due to crowded living conditions, limited sanitation, and inadequate healthcare access. Diseases such as cholera, diarrheal illnesses, and measles are commonly reported in these environments. These outbreaks can spread rapidly among populations with weakened immune systems.
Vaccine-preventable diseases like polio and hepatitis B also pose significant threats in refugee settings. Outbreaks of respiratory infections, including pneumonia, are frequent due to poor ventilation and close contact among residents. Malaria transmission may increase in camps situated in endemic regions, especially when vector control measures are insufficient.
The challenging living conditions and limited healthcare infrastructure in refugee camps exacerbate disease transmission. The convergence of these factors results in predictable patterns of disease outbreaks, emphasizing the need for targeted interventions. Addressing these prevalent diseases is vital to safeguarding the health of displaced populations and preventing escalation into larger public health crises.
Factors Contributing to Disease Spread
Several interconnected factors facilitate the spread of disease within refugee camps. Overcrowding significantly reduces personal space, increasing close contact and the likelihood of transmission of infectious agents. High population densities make effective disease containment challenging and accelerate outbreaks.
Poor sanitation and inadequate water supply are critical contributors to disease proliferation. Without proper waste disposal and access to clean water, pathogens such as cholera, dysentery, and other waterborne diseases thrive, posing severe health risks to vulnerable populations. These conditions often prevail due to infrastructure limitations.
Limited healthcare infrastructure exacerbates disease spread. Insufficient medical facilities, shortages of vaccines, and delayed response times hinder early detection and treatment. These gaps allow infectious diseases to establish footholds and worsen rapidly within the camp environment.
Lastly, environmental and seasonal factors, such as hot and humid climates, facilitate the survival and transmission of many pathogens. Coupled with factors like poor hygiene practices and inadequate health education, these elements create an environment highly conducive to disease outbreaks in refugee settings.

Disease Surveillance and Rapid Response Teams
Disease surveillance and rapid response teams are vital components in managing health risks within refugee camps. These teams monitor disease patterns continuously to detect early signs of outbreaks, helping to contain potential health crises promptly. Their proactive approach minimizes the spread of infectious diseases in often overcrowded and resource-limited settings.
These teams collect data from clinics, community reports, and laboratory results to identify unusual illness trends. Rapid response teams are then mobilized swiftly to investigate and implement control measures, such as isolation, treatment, and targeted vaccinations. This coordination is essential to prevent outbreaks from escalating.
Effective disease surveillance and rapid response are particularly important in refugee camps affected by war and displacement, where health infrastructure may be compromised. International agencies and NGOs often lead these efforts, ensuring timely interventions. Their work helps maintain public health security amid complex humanitarian challenges.
Vaccination Campaigns and Health Education
Vaccination campaigns and health education are vital components in controlling disease outbreaks within refugee camps. They ensure that populations at risk receive essential immunizations, reducing the spread of preventable diseases such as cholera, measles, and polio.
Effective vaccination campaigns require careful planning, coordination, and community mobilization. Mobile clinics and outreach teams are often used to reach displaced populations who may lack access to fixed health facilities. This approach increases immunization coverage and helps break the transmission chain of infectious diseases.
Health education complements vaccination efforts by informing refugees about disease prevention, hygiene practices, and the importance of completing immunization schedules. Clear, culturally sensitive communication encourages community participation and dispels misconceptions surrounding vaccines. Such education fosters trust and enhances the overall effectiveness of disease control measures in refugee camps.

Improving Water, Sanitation, and Hygiene (WASH) Measures
Improving water, sanitation, and hygiene measures in refugee camps is fundamental to controlling disease outbreaks. Access to clean water reduces the transmission of waterborne illnesses such as cholera and dysentery. Ensuring safe and sufficient water supplies is thus a priority for health authorities.
Sanitation infrastructure, including the construction of latrines and waste disposal systems, helps prevent environmental contamination. Proper waste management minimizes the spread of pathogens that can cause disease outbreaks, especially in densely populated camp settings.
Hygiene promotion campaigns are also vital. Education on handwashing with soap, safe food handling, and personal cleanliness encourages behaviors that reduce disease transmission. Engaging community members in hygiene practices fosters sustainable health improvements and resilience.
Implementing these measures requires coordinated efforts between international agencies, local governments, and NGOs. Adequate funding, technical support, and monitoring are essential to maintain and upgrade WASH facilities, ultimately decreasing the risk of disease outbreaks among vulnerable refugee populations.
Strengthening Medical Supply Chains
Strengthening medical supply chains is vital for ensuring timely access to essential medicines, vaccines, and equipment in refugee camps. Efficient logistics and inventory management reduce delays and prevent stockouts during disease outbreaks. Reliable transportation routes are essential to maintain a steady flow of supplies, especially in remote or conflict-affected areas.
Establishing robust supply chain systems involves coordinating with international agencies, local suppliers, and humanitarian organizations. This coordination ensures availability of critical items and minimizes duplication of efforts. Implementing digital tracking systems can help monitor stock levels and forecast future needs accurately.
Addressing vulnerabilities in supply chains enhances the overall resilience of health responses in refugee camps. By securing consistent delivery of medical supplies, agencies can better manage disease outbreaks and reduce morbidity and mortality. Investing in local procurement and storage facilities also reduces dependency on external shipments and improves response times.
